Reuters reported that German steel distributor Kloeckner & Co is not working on a bid for Thyssenkrupp’s Materials Services unit. A spokesman for the company said in response to a media report that “There are currently neither talks between Kloeckner & Co and Thyssenkrupp over a tie-up with the Material Services division nor are we preparing an offer for it.”
German monthly Manager Magazin earlier reported that Kloeckner CEO Gisbert Ruehl would soon propose a joint venture under the leadership of his company, taking advantage of growing shareholder criticism over Thyssenkrupp’s slow turnaround.
Ruehl had said in October that parts of Thyssenkrupp’s Materials Services, which generates more than twice the annual sales of Kloeckner, would be a good strategic fit.
About two thirds of Materials Services’ EUR 13.8 billion in sales come from Thyssenkrupp’s materials distribution business, which competes with Kloeckner, Salzgitter and U.S.-listed Reliance Steel & Aluminum.
